我尝试使用CUFFT修改Shield Tablet上的CUDA样本。但是,当我构建程序时,我收到了链接错误:undefined reference to 'cufftExecR2C'
; undefined reference to 'cufftExecC2R'
。
我认为错误可能是由于缺少.so文件造成的。然后我在中添加了libcufft.so Android.mk文件,如:
include $(CLEAR_VARS)
LOCAL_MODULE := libcufft
LOCAL_LIB_PATH += $(CUDA_TOOLKIT_ROOT)/targets/armv7-linux- androideabi/lib/
LOCAL_SRC_FILES := $(LOCAL_LIB_PATH)/libcufft.so
include $(PREBUILT_SHARED_LIBRARY)
我仍然遇到同样的错误。有人可以帮助我并指出正确的方向吗?
非常感谢。